Middlesex County is home to the Friendship Club, now in its 13th year, dedicated to enlisting and empowering area youth to organize and demonstrate their care for special needs children, the elderly and the infirm. Each week on Fridays, the teens and university students, ranging in age between 12 and 23, mobilize and visit residents of the area hospitals and homes of special needs children. They distributing flowers, gifts and toys and engage the participants in enjoyable artistic and theatrical activities.
The youth who are all part of Chabad’s leadership program, also conduct musical performances, create scrapbooks of seniors' lives, and participate in fun activities and projects. bringing smiles on the faces of the all participants. We also have enlisted a professional with a degree in special education and early childhood intervention working along side with these children and families.
